Output 31e50c23117c608b8c5bdb7cf85b442d677d9ccf255d3e54026b650b03c8428c:0

value
1199553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f7d965880395aaf7db60f820cff5c3cbc66e64 OP_EQUAL
address
MUQgWGKPBYNtkxKFLeFUrDfjXiCFGvUozn
transaction
31e50c23117c608b8c5bdb7cf85b442d677d9ccf255d3e54026b650b03c8428c
spent
true